Home | History | Annotate | Download | only in include
History log of /src/sys/arch/sparc/include/ctlreg.h
RevisionDateAuthorComments
 1.32  10-Mar-2024  rillig sparc: fix snprintb formats for SFSR_BITS
 1.31  06-Sep-2021  andvar fix various typos in comments.
 1.30  29-Aug-2019  msaitoh Add missing NUL to prevent buffer overrun.
 1.29  04-Dec-2013  jdc branches: 1.29.22; 1.29.30; 1.29.34;
Clarify comment about SER_SZERR.
 1.28  11-Dec-2005  christos branches: 1.28.112; 1.28.122; 1.28.128;
merge ktrace-lwp.
 1.27  10-Sep-2005  uwe Add definitions for microSPARC-IIep memory fault registers.
 1.26  27-Apr-2004  pk branches: 1.26.12;
Bits 0 (MMU Enable) and 1 (Fault inhibit) are common among the implementations
of the SRMMU control register. Reflect that fact in the definitions here.

Also add the swift `store allocate' bit.
 1.25  13-Feb-2004  wiz Uppercase CPU, plural is CPUs.
 1.24  31-Dec-2002  pk branches: 1.24.2;
Add some more definitions: SRMMU and MXCC reset register.
 1.23  24-Aug-2002  thorpej Add Sun4d cpu-unit ASIs.
 1.22  05-May-2000  pk branches: 1.22.8; 1.22.12; 1.22.20;
Define some more bits in the MXCC control register.
 1.21  01-May-2000  pk Add definitions of HyperSPARC block fill/copy ASIs.
 1.20  30-Apr-2000  pk Rename MXCC control register.
Add MXCC stream register definitions.
 1.19  19-Jan-1999  pk branches: 1.19.8;
Define Hypersparc ICCR bits.
 1.18  20-Sep-1998  pk Name fault registers more like they're referred to in various docs.
 1.17  06-Sep-1998  pk Use the new "%b" format.
 1.16  26-Jul-1998  pk Define hypersparc instruction-cache flush ASI.
 1.15  20-Jul-1997  pk Remove a couple of "ms2 only" from cache-flush ASIs.
 1.14  06-Jul-1997  pk Define the turbosparc's processor configuration register.
 1.13  22-Mar-1997  pk For each major "module", define a separate set of MMU control register bits.
 1.12  16-May-1996  abrown Copyright police (s/Harvard University/Harvard College/).
 1.11  15-May-1996  mrg remove some RCS id's we don't need.
 1.10  31-Mar-1996  pk Add SRMMU/sun4m definitions.
Cleanup (i.e. mostly delete) `#if defined (SUN4*)' in here.
 1.9  23-Oct-1995  pk Define VIDEO enable bit (per Jason Thorpe; PR#1672).
 1.8  25-Jun-1995  pk add a couple more sun4m bits.
 1.7  13-Apr-1995  pk Add `region' ASI.
 1.6  20-Nov-1994  deraadt copyright/Id cleanup
 1.5  26-Oct-1994  deraadt vme, and cleanup some messy #ifdef stuff
 1.4  20-Aug-1994  deraadt add sun4 control space areas
 1.3  04-Jul-1994  deraadt add srmmu flush/prope ASI sub-codes
 1.2  05-May-1994  deraadt add sun4m ASI definitions
 1.1  02-Oct-1993  deraadt Chris Torek's sparc port. Missing lots of things.
 1.19.8.1  20-Nov-2000  bouyer Update thorpej_scsipi to -current as of a month ago
A i386 GENERIC kernel compiles without the siop, ahc and bha drivers
(will be updated later). i386 IDE/ATAPI and ncr work, as well as
sparc/esp_sbus. alpha should work as well (untested yet).
siop, ahc and bha will be updated once I've updated the branch to current
-current, as well as machine-dependant code.
 1.22.20.1  31-Aug-2002  gehenna catch up with -current.
 1.22.12.2  03-Jan-2003  thorpej Sync with HEAD.

XXX ALT_SWITCH_CODE is not yet LWP'ified.
 1.22.12.1  27-Aug-2002  nathanw Catch up to -current.
 1.22.8.1  06-Sep-2002  jdolecek sync kqueue branch with HEAD
 1.24.2.4  10-Nov-2005  skrll Sync with HEAD. Here we go again...
 1.24.2.3  21-Sep-2004  skrll Fix the sync with head I botched.
 1.24.2.2  18-Sep-2004  skrll Sync with HEAD.
 1.24.2.1  03-Aug-2004  skrll Sync with HEAD
 1.26.12.1  21-Jun-2006  yamt sync with head.
 1.28.128.1  18-May-2014  rmind sync with head
 1.28.122.1  20-Aug-2014  tls Rebase to HEAD as of a few days ago.
 1.28.112.1  22-May-2014  yamt sync with head.

for a reference, the tree before this commit was tagged
as yamt-pagecache-tag8.

this commit was splitted into small chunks to avoid
a limitation of cvs. ("Protocol error: too many arguments")
 1.29.34.1  01-Sep-2019  martin Pull up following revision(s) (requested by msaitoh in ticket #145):

sys/arch/sparc/include/ctlreg.h: revision 1.30
sys/dev/pci/if_xgereg.h: revision 1.3

Add missing NUL to prevent buffer overrun.
 1.29.30.1  13-Apr-2020  martin Mostly merge changes from HEAD upto 20200411
 1.29.22.1  26-Sep-2019  martin Pull up following revision(s) (requested by msaitoh in ticket #1387):

sys/arch/sparc/include/ctlreg.h: revision 1.30
sys/dev/pci/if_xgereg.h: revision 1.3

Add missing NUL to prevent buffer overrun.

RSS XML Feed